Roko is a title used by Fijians of chiefly rank specifically from the Lau Islands. Its equivalent from the Kubuna Confederacy is the Bauan form of Ratu and Ro from parts of the Burebasaga Confederacy. This title was widely used amongst members of the chiefly Vuanirewa clan up to the mid 19th century. Increasing intercourse amongst the chiefly households of Lakeba and Bau, thereafter, saw the increasing use of Ratu and Adi by members of the Vuanirewa dynasty, for instance, the current heir to the Tui Nayau title, Finau Mara uses the Baun title Ratu instead of Roko as do most his siblings. The exception however is his younger brother Tevita Uluilakeba who uses the title Roko, often shortened to Roko Ului.

The title Roko is not gender specific as it would also be used equally to denote Vuanirewa women of rank.
